
Explore a stunning world, make complex moral choices, and engage in bone-crushing combat against massive and terrifying creatures. The Ultimate Edition includes Dragon Age: Origins, Dragon Age: Origins - Awakening and all nine content packs.

A dense, dark and astonishing powerhouse of ol' school RPGing that has tons of surprises in store for anyone willing to give it the attention it deserves. It really scratches a particular itch in storytelling with some of the most complex layering of character-driven interactions I've ever come across, the amount of possibilities is astounding. I wish I had a greater desire to explore all the possibilities, but I want to add that the combat felt like a slog and a few of the important party NPCs felt undercooked. At least there's something for everybody, and I rightly accepted this after some initial personal prejudices had to be overcome. When that was done, the enjoyment was much greater. All in all I had a blast in Ferelden, with no technical hurdles despite the game's age, which is lovely to see! Might check out other DA games, though I have heard this is by far the most complex installment. Who knows, maybe I'll play the DLC called "Awakenings" one day?
